Hundreds of individuals attended a funeral in Haiti to mourn four victims of a brutal gang attack. This event occurred in the context of an attack that ultimately claimed the lives of 47 people.
The gathering marked a solemn occasion for the community, reflecting the profound impact of the violence. The attendance of hundreds underscores the collective grief and the scale of the tragedy.
